Here’s ‘South Park’s’ very unsubtle take on the Colin Kaepernick controversy

Colin Kaepernick's national anthem protest has blown up in the news since the San Francisco 49ers quarterback first sat for the “Star-Spangled Banner” on August 26, and now South Park has weighed in on the matter in this first clip from the show's 20th season opener. The show is clearly taking aim at what creators Trey Parker and Matt Stone see as the hypocrisy behind some of the current anti-police rhetoric, and to make their point they've bluntly rewritten the national anthem to suit their message. In classic South Park fashion, there is nothing subtle about it.
